Re: WINDFEST 2009 - Poole
Just A quick report on Rockley park where we stayed
Euro pitches, Tarmac and Gravel, Hook up and waste £21.00 a night.
Entertainment up to the usual Haven standard, Nearby beach OK generally friendly.
Windfest -
Well parking £8.20 a day advised to get there early so we had breakfast there at 08:15 to get our money's worth
Beach excellent, all the sports were there, bikes, boards, boats, power boats, Kite boarding and Windsurfing. only problem was the windsurfing that happened was so far out to see anyone could have won.

Ben ensures crowd control at the bike show.

Le mans boat start

Poole Harbour

A nice view (If you can get it on the Haven Site)

Went to look round the expensive housing and no offence to anyone if you live there, but it seemed very busy on the roads, and for a couple of million I would not like the queues of traffic by my house....
a good couple of days and worth a visit.
Regards Mr and Mrs P
